Web4 hours ago · “(Michael) Jordan was a reluctant passer. He didn’t like to pass and he was the first volume shooter… He didn’t have great handles. (Michael Jordan) Couldn’t go left. And if he went left more than 2-3 times, he had to pick it up. So, the (Jordan) rules were very simple. Left side of the floor, send him left. WebNov 3, 2024 · The Pistons advertised their "Jordan rules" as some secret defense that only they could deploy to stop Jordan. These secrets were merely a series of funneling defenses that channeled Jordan toward the crowded middle, but Detroit players and coaches talked about them as if they had been devised by the Pentagon. WebThe Jordan Rules were a successful defensive basketball strategy employed by the Detroit Pistons against Michael Jordan in order to limit his effectiveness in any game.
